Live the story and visit Paris in the footsteps of the characters in Dan Brown's famous novel adapted for the screen by Ron Howard. Robert Langdon lived at the Ritz Hotel and walked through the Place Vendome, the rue St Honore and the rue de Richelieu before going to the Louvre. You will pass there at the beginning of the morning. With Sophie Neveu, he drove up the Champs-Elysees, round the Arc de Triomphe and stopped at the Gare Saint-Lazare: you will also discover these places before your guided visit of the Louvre Museum. Your guide-chauffeur, a real expert on the "Da Vinci Code" will take you through the main rooms where the action takes place and show you at the same time the masterpieces that are mentioned: Mona Lisa, Virgin of the Rocks, Venus of Milo... An emotional moment: the discovery of the inverted pyramid. Evidence could still be there... During the cruise-lunch (drink included) you will admire other monuments mentioned in the novel: Eiffel Tower, Orsay Museum and more. The afternoon starts off with free time to visit St Sulpice Church and find out what Silas the priest was looking for. Finally you will follow the famous "Rose line" to discover one of Arago's medallions (Peter Langdon talks about it in his epilogue), close to the Seine "Quai Conti". From April 01, 2007 the cruise will be replaced by lunch at a restaurant located on the "Rose Line".
